What Is a Jersey Knit Comforter?

A jersey knit comforter is made from jersey fabric—the same knit used in T-shirts and loungewear. Unlike crisp woven fabrics, jersey knit is created with interlocking loops of yarn, which gives it a naturally soft, stretchy, and breathable feel.

Instead of feeling stiff or slippery, a jersey knit comforter feels:

  • Soft and flexible

  • Gently drapey

  • Comfortable from day one (no breaking-in period)

It’s designed to feel relaxed, cozy, and lived-in—without sacrificing style.


Why Jersey Knit Feels So Different (and So Comfortable)

The secret is in the knit construction. Because jersey knit stretches slightly and allows airflow, it adapts to your body instead of sitting stiffly on top of it.

That means:

  • Less trapped heat

  • Better breathability

  • A lighter, more natural feel

For people who toss, turn, or tend to overheat at night, this makes a noticeable difference.
